Leadership Review Briefing — Budget Ask

Quick one before Thursday's session: the Larkfield Platform team is requesting an additional tranche to cover tooling upgrades and two vendor contracts. It's a modest bump versus last cycle, and the payback case looks solid — roughly 14 months. Ops and Product have both signed off. Heads of department, please skim the figures beforehand. The confidential business rationale is noted just below.

board note of bawep-tajef: Queniusek Systems plans to raise the Quenvan list price by 53.1 percent in March. The pricing group signed off on a budget of $176.4 million for Project Drueth. The renewal with Casionix Partners closes at $142.5 million a year, 8.3 percent below the last contract. Project Fraax slips by six weeks because of the tooling delay.

## Configuration: Export Memory Limits (Ledgervane)

Spreadsheet exports in Ledgervane stream rows in 5,000-row chunks to cap worker memory near 512 MB. If on-call sees OOM kills, lower EXPORT_CHUNK_ROWS before scaling the pod; raising memory masks the real issue. Exports larger than 200k rows are offloaded to the Fennich batch tier, which requires authenticated access to the export store. Put that credential on the line immediately following this sentence.

vault entry, kagep-yajeg: COURIER_KEY5=da097

## Runbook: SDK Parity — Quillcast Android/iOS Clients

For the weekly eng sync: parity between the Quillcast Android and iOS SDKs is tracked by the Mirrorline job, which diffs the public API surface nightly and files gaps automatically. Current policy: no feature ships on one platform more than one minor version ahead of the other unless the Parity Board grants an exception. When a gap alert fires, check whether the flag rollout stages match before assuming missing code. The Mirrorline job runs against these settings:

deployment values, kajep-kageg:
[praix]
host = praix.paliqcorp.corp
user = praix_svc
database = praix_prod